Output e849cc640c44a0c1d2a5c8466287161683626fa2d0d24e0469037e6eaff9d0c9:2

value
184838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3c3fdb659dd2d6c147588d13b113c999526a3a1 OP_EQUAL
address
3LzjHiaya8P4Rx2pTjeTs1Fv6h8XpmQbpR
transaction
e849cc640c44a0c1d2a5c8466287161683626fa2d0d24e0469037e6eaff9d0c9
confirmations
53232
spent
true